Great vehicle, 8 years in
by George C on 6/30/2026 9:16:09 PM
88K miles, very few issues. A couple of recalls (mostly software), one warranty repair for some front suspension bits, and one post-warranty repair for a front suspension part (honestly it may not have been needed; dealer wasn't that competent and the noise ended up being just a brake dust shield that needed to be bent back a little). Most city driving on battery only; on colder days with heat on, range on battery drops to ~20 or less; otherwise can consistently get 25-27 in the city on a charge. Freeway mileage OK (27mpg at 75, down to 25 for trips with extended "brisk" driving). Can hold a ton of stuff. Comfortable; two adults in 3rd row OK. Handles surprisingly well (low center of mass due to battery). For those doing mostly highway driving, this won't make much sense (get the Sienna for best mileage), but if you do a good amount of city daily driving <25 miles, this is a wonderful vehicle - all electric for these commutes, and then you have the gas motor for longer trips. Other than annual oil changes, the occasional air / cabin air filters, tires, no other maintenance thus far. Brake pads and rotors still look new. Interior has held up well. 12V battery still good. Very happy with this vehicle so far. - 5.0

Dad is gonna LOVE this van!
by ChumLao on 7/9/2025 4:35:48 AM
I drive the 2024 Pacifica plug in hybrid. My particular vehicle is work issued and has a rack in the back so it only has the two front seats available for passenger and driver. I load the rack of shelves in the back with the parts to repair the devices that I fix therefore it has more than the standard amount of weight in the back for comparison. This van is fast ignore the 260 hp rating, that’s for the electric motors which are completely different than a gas driven engine that has 260 hp. The acceleration is instantaneous you want power? Ok HERE! Have some power but in a completely controlled way. The engine kicks on but its not connected to the driveline so their is no torque steer. It just goes. Think of the throttle as a “wish granter” you step on the pedal and your wish is granted. I am continually amazed at how hard this thing will pull when you step on it. I am by no means a non-aggressive driver however I am trying to be a much more of a team player when I’m out on the highway. This vehicle ends the argument instantly. “NO I am going to pass you.” That brings me to the adaptive cruise control. This is amazing stuff right here. Didn’t think I’d like it. Yeah I love it. You can set it and forget it. You can change the distance between you and the car in front of you so if traffic gets kinda heavy, you don’t have to leave a huge hole for everybody to merge into. You can also adjust the speed it maxes out at. Then there’s the drive mode called L for some reason. This is like an extra set of brakes No kidding throw this on at 70-75 miles an hour and watch the car immediately come down from speed completely under control. Add the brake pedal to the equation and it stops even faster again completely under control. Another feature of the L setting is that when put here and your driving through speed bumps or dips or severe corners in a parking lot, the suspension hunkers down, and the body roll is almost completely negated to where when you maneuver through what used to be a rather jostling ride is now completely smooth. Dips and speed bumps disappear. I have enjoyed driving my entire life, and I never thought I would like an electric vehicle. Let alone a van. I am more of a sedan / sports car / race car kinda guy. Take one of these on a test drive Find a nice long straight stretch of deserted road and get the vehicle up to 60-70 miles an hour (or whatever is safe) then put it into L and step on the brakes progressively hard (but SLOWLY) and watch just how fast this thing slows down. Remember, my review is with at least 600 pounds of equipment in the back of the van on racks. None of my items move an inch. They all stay exactly where they’re supposed to because the van doesn’t really pitch forward when you step on the brakes under L it just kind of stops very quickly. Again, try it and see if you don’t just love it. Oh and yes it does get good gas mileage, I doubt I am getting what everyone else is but I have a huge smile on my face as I enjoy this vehicle.
